Full funding for qualification costs, including two exams, to achieve a Certificate in Financial Planning.

Study materials including textbooks, past exam practice papers and exam vouchers.

Chartered Insurance Institute membership for a full year.

Access to a learning platform with plain-English study texts, video tutorials and online exam-prep.

Regular workshops for top tips and insight into the financial services industry.

One to ones with an experienced mentor to chat through challenges and keep you on track.

An active, supportive community of Verve Foundation peers.

Opportunities for practical work experience.

Job opportunities from our partners and help securing a role in the industry once qualified.

Study spans 6 months, with 2 exams across the full period, about 3 or 4 months apart.  

Preparation for each exam includes 3 types of learning: self-study, one to ones and workshops.  

Self-study: Flexible enough to fit alongside everyday life! Study in your spare time, on a structured timeline that suits you.  

One to ones: You’ll have regular get-togethers with the Verve Foundation team. They’ll keep you on track and lend expertise, support and guidance.

Workshops: A chance to connect with your cohort peers, and better understand the industry, job roles available, and what to expect after qualification.  

To be successful on the New Talent programme, we ask that you:

  • Commit to around 80 hours of self-study across 6 months.

  • Attend all your workshops (or watch the recordings).

  • Commit to every single one to one session with openness and honesty.

  • Integrate yourself in the community by seeking help and supporting others.

  • Ask questions. Lots and lots of questions!
